Aruna ratanagiri buddhist monastery harnham buddhist monastery is a theravada buddhist monastery of the thai forest tradition in northumberland, england. The primary focus for aruna ratanagiri monastery is to provide and maintain a sanctuary suitable for the training and ongoing practice of theravada bhikkhus, in keeping with the pali vinaya and forest tradition of northeast thailand.
